How Have Plumbing Codes And Regulations Evolved From Mid-century To The Present Day?
Gathering question image...
Introduction
The transformation of plumbing codes and regulations from the mid-20th century to today showcases significant shifts in society, technology, and environmental awareness. This evolution not only enhances public health and safety but also meets the growing demands of modern plumbing systems and practices.
A Historical Overview of Plumbing Codes
During the mid-20th century, plumbing codes were simplistic, concentrating on fundamental safety and sanitation issues, including access to clean drinking water. As urban development progressed and public health concerns escalated, plumbing codes underwent significant changes. Initially designed without integrating modern materials or technologies, these early plumbing systems often posed health risks due to contamination and inefficiency.
- In the 1950s, plumbing regulations primarily addressed basic health issues, focusing on preventing sewage contamination and securing access to safe drinking water.
- The introduction of innovative materials like PVC in the 1960s revolutionized plumbing solutions, enabling more flexible, durable, and efficient installations.
Contemporary Plumbing Regulations
Today’s plumbing codes are detailed and comprehensive, addressing not only safety concerns but also the environmental impact and sustainability of plumbing systems. These regulations incorporate cutting-edge advancements in technology and materials that promote resource conservation. Modern codes emphasize the importance of regulating water-efficient fixtures and systems to minimize environmental harm, aligning with an eco-friendly plumbing approach.
- The implementation of green plumbing standards fosters energy and water conservation, supporting wider sustainability initiatives.
- Regular revisions to plumbing codes cater to emerging technologies, such as smart plumbing solutions and enhanced water conservation methods.
Significant Changes Over the Decades
The evolution of plumbing regulations over the decades showcases several pivotal changes that underscore an enhanced understanding of building science, public health imperatives, and environmental responsibility. These developments highlight the essential role of safe and sustainable plumbing practices in contemporary society.
- Increased emphasis on cross-connection control and backflow prevention measures to safeguard drinking water supplies.
- Stricter regulations regarding lead materials, including the prohibition of lead pipes in residences initiated by the Safe Drinking Water Act amendments.
- The establishment of the International Plumbing Code (IPC), which sets standardized plumbing practices across various jurisdictions, improving safety and interoperability.
